Korean verbs can remain in their infinitive “dictionary form” (ending in 다) or become conjugated to take on specific implications. Conjugations. The basic rule of Korean verb conjugation is to take the stem of the verb in its infinitive form and give it a new ending.

The copulas conjugate like stative verbs, but the existential verbs conjugate like action verbs. Some verbs can be either stative or active, depending on meaning. Forms. Korean verbs are conjugated. Every verb form in Korean has two parts: a verb stem, simple or expanded, plus a sequence of inflectional suffixes. Conjugation Rule 2: If the last vowel in a verb stem is NOT ㅏ or ㅗ, then you add 어요. Let’s look at some examples: 먹다 (to eat) in the present tense is 먹어요. After removing ‘ 다 ‘ you are left with the verb stem ‘ 먹 ‘ As you can see, the last vowel is not ㅏ or ㅗ. The last vowel in 먹 is ㅓ. Find out the rules, examples, and tips for Korean conjugation with a free PDF guide and a verb conjugator.2 days ago · 낫다 (natda | to recover) -> 나아요 (naayo) ㅂ irregular. The ㅂ Batchim is replaced with 우, then added to the following conjugation Korean word. 눕다 (nupda | to lie down) -> 누워요 (nuwoyo) *우+어 ->워. ㅡ irregular.
